Resource Description: The Hamburg/ESO survey (HES) is a digital objective prism survey covering the total southern extragalactic sky. It is based on Kodak IIIa-J plates which have been taken with the 1m ESO Schmidt telescope and its 4° prism. The spectral coverage is 3200-5300 Å, at an resolution of 15 Å at H gamma. This is a collection of uniformly reduced spectra prepared by Norbert Christlieb.
